Build concrete core filled masonry block arches without a template See also: Masonry Arch Header Cut and Placement Calculator

How it works When the wall is core filled, the membrane (flashing) around the arch line stops the concrete. Remove off-cuts and extra blocks to reveal the arch.

Cut all the blocks before construction. The cut blocks (all halves) that form the arch are numbered sequentially, with off-cuts numbered identically. Take the opening to spring height, then using a standard horizontal head support, go across the head, laying each cut in its place, its matching off-cut on top, with a membrane (aluminum flashing is ideal) between the two. Lay the cut, place the flashing on top of the cut line and lay the off-cut to lock membrane in place.
Use overlapping lengths of thick, strong (aluminum) flashing about 3 feet long so the flashing doesn't get in your way.


An arch has 2 identical sets of cuts
(left and right sides). A bulls-eye (circle) has 4.

Circular Raking Walls with Arch or Bullseye You can easily combine this Template-less Arch System with the Circular Wall System to build circular walls with arches.
Neither system requires a string line, so they combine easily.

If you're cutting blocks, concrete, stone or ANYTHING and there's DUST - DON'T TAKE THE RISK
Don't cut it, or cut it wet so there's NO DUST - Silicosis Sucks
And if you're cutting wet, wear a mask - there's dust in the spray mist too!
